photorec이 마지막으로 저장된 파일을 복원할 수 없습니다

photorec이 마지막으로 저장된 파일을 복원할 수 없습니다

어제 나는 현재 디렉토리에 있는 많은 c 프로그램의 내용을 실수로 삭제했습니다. 나중에 모든 파일을 성공적으로 복구했습니다.(photorec 명령을 사용하세요)질문이 있습니다.

문제는 1개의 파일에 대해 마지막으로 저장된 콘텐츠가 복원되지 않은 것으로 나타났습니다. 무슨 말인지 설명하자면, 파일을 작성하고 저장한 다음 다시 편집하고 저장하고 편집합니다... 해당 파일의 경우 복구된 파일에 많은 파일이 존재하는 것을 확인합니다. 복구된 파일 1개에는 해당 파일에 대한 5줄의 코드가 있고, 다른 30줄도 있습니다. 하지만 마지막으로 파일을 저장했을 때 존재했던 내용은 복원할 수 없습니다. 즉, 파일의 중간 내용은 복구되지만 마지막으로 저장된 내용은 복구된 파일에 존재하지 않는다는 것입니다. 왜 이런 일이 일어나는지 아는 사람이 있나요? 이전 콘텐츠가 복원되면 마지막으로 저장된 콘텐츠가 복원된 파일에 분명히 존재해야 하는 것처럼 보이기 때문입니다.

이 Q의 결과는이 게시물.

관련 정보